About agriculture in Dera Nanak
Located in the Gurdaspur district of Punjab, Dera Nanak lies on the banks of the Ravi River, close to the international border. The surrounding landscape consists of vast, flat fertile plains characteristic of the Majha region. The rural periphery is dominated by a grid-like pattern of green fields crisscrossed by irrigation canals that draw water from the river basin.
The agriculture here is intensive and follows the traditional wheat-paddy cycle. During the summer, rice paddies dominate the view, while winter sees the fields turn gold with wheat and yellow with mustard crops. Sugarcane and various vegetables are also cultivated, supported by rich alluvial soil. Livestock rearing, particularly dairy farming with buffaloes and cows, is an integral part of most farm households.
